High Priority 2

#3High Priority35A-02-7

High Priority – – From initial inspection : High Priority – Live, flying insects found 1live flying insects on prep area 1 live flying insect on cook line 1 live flying on drive thru area 1 live flying on front counter in were steam well is located 3 live flying insects behind table on front counter 5 live flying insects on wall in front counter next to middle man . 8 live flying insects on wall with bulletin board by front counter Approximately 15 live flying insects under utility sink in dish area . Total = Approximately 35 live flying insects Warning** **Admin Complaint** – From follow-up inspection 2026-07-14: 1 flying insect on front counter wall by poster board 1 flying insect by handing located on dish are sink 1 flying insect on prep area 2 flying insects under dish area Total = 5 flying insects **Time Extended**

WarningAdmin Complaint
#4High Priority03B-01-6

High Priority – – From initial inspection : High Priority – Time/temperature control for safety food, other than whole meat roast, hot held at less than 135 degrees Fahrenheit. Collard greens kept on drive thru area with temperature of 120F . Kept for two hours . Inspector ask manager to reheat up to 165F . Fries kept on steam well with temperature of 123F , discarded . **Warning** – From follow-up inspection 2026-07-14: **Time Extended**

#7Intermediate51-16-7

Intermediate – – From initial inspection : Intermediate – No plan review submitted and approved – renovations were made or are in progress. Must submit plans and plan review application to DBPR H and R Plan Review office located at 2601 Blair Stone Rd., Tallahassee, FL 32399-1011. Plans must be submitted AND approved within 60 days. The direct link to the Plan Review page is https://www2.myfloridalicense.com/hotels-restaurants/licensing/plan-review/. Facility added a soda machine to drive thru area. Facility removed a hand sink located in cook line by kitchen entrance and a hand sink by oven in prep area. **Warning** – From follow-up inspection 2026-07-14: **Time Extended**
